Understanding Consumer Directed Personal Assistance Program (CDPAP)

CDPAP is a Medicaid-funded program that enables individuals with disabilities or chronic illnesses to hire and direct their own caregivers. Unlike traditional home care services, where an agency assigns a caregiver, CDPAP allows individuals to choose, train, and supervise their own caregivers, who can include family members or close friends.

By participating in CDPAP, individuals have the freedom to select caregivers they trust, ensuring that their specific needs and preferences are met. This program promotes independence, as it empowers individuals to actively manage their care, fostering a sense of control and dignity.

Who Qualifies for CDPAP

CDPAP is designed to provide assistance to individuals who require long-term care and have the desire to have more control over their care. To qualify for CDPAP, individuals must meet the following criteria:

  1. Medical Eligibility: The individual must have a medical condition or disability that requires ass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s) or skilled nursing tasks.
  2. Self-Direction: The individual must have the ability to direct their own care or have a designated representative who can act on their behalf.
  3. Medicaid Eligibility: CDPAP is primarily funded through Medicaid, so individuals must meet the Medicaid eligibility requirements in their state. This includes meeting income and asset limits.
  4. Approval by Managed Care Organization (MCO): If the individual is enrolled in a managed care plan, they must receive approval from their MCO to participate in CDPAP.
  5. Legal Authorization: In some cases, the individual may need legal authorization, such as a power of attorney or guardianship, to enroll in CDPAP.

Documentation and Requirements

To participate in CDPAP, individuals are required to provide certain documentation and fulfill specific requirements. These may vary slightly depending on the state and managed care plan. The typical documentation and requirements include:

Documentation/Requirement Description
Description Requirements
Physician's Order A signed physician's order is needed, indicating that the individual requires ass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s) or skilled nursing tasks.
Plan of Care A comprehensive plan of care must be developed by a healthcare professional, outlining the specific care needs and services required.
Personal Assistant Selection The individual or their designated representative must select a personal assistant who will provide the care. The personal assistant must meet certain qualifications and pass a background check.
Training Requirements Personal assistants may be required to undergo training, which can vary by state and managed care plan. This may include training on infection control, emergency procedures, and client rights.
Timesheet Submission Timesheets must be accurately completed and submitted to the fiscal intermediary or managed care plan for payment processing.

It's important to consult with the appropriate agency or managed care plan to ensure compliance with all documentation and requirements. Selecting a Caregiver for CDPAP

Choosing a caregiver for CDPAP requires careful consideration to ensure compatibility and trust. Here are a few important factors to keep in mind:

  1. Relationship: Consider whether you would prefer a caregiver who is a family member, friend, or someone you trust. This personal connection can enhance the level of comfort and establish a foundation of trust.
  2. Skills and Experience: Assess the caregiver's skills and experience in providing the specific care and assistance you require. This may include tasks such as personal care, medication management, or mobility assistance.
  3. Availability: Determine the availability of the caregiver and whether their schedule aligns with your needs. It's important to ensure that the caregiver can commit to the required hours of care and has the flexibility to accommodate any changes in scheduling.
  4. Training and Certification: Look for caregivers who have received proper training and certification in relevant areas, such as CPR or first aid. This demonstrates their commitment to providing quality care and their ability to handle emergencies.
  5. Compatibility: Consider the caregiver's personality and communication style to ensure compatibility. Effective communication is essential for a positive caregiving relationship, allowing for open dialogue and the ability to address any concerns or preferences.

Remember, selecting a caregiver is a personal decision, and it's important to trust your instincts and prioritize your comfort and well-being.

Developing a Care Plan

Developing a care plan involves assessing the care recipient's specific requirements and designing a personalized approach to meet those needs. This process may involve the participation of the care recipient, family members, healthcare professionals, and the chosen caregiver.

To develop an effective care plan, it is important to consider the following factors:

  1. Healthcare Needs: Assess the care recipient's healthcare needs, including any medical conditions, disabilities, or limitations that require attention. This information will help determine the level of care required and the necessary tasks that the caregiver should be trained for.
  2. Daily Activities: Identify the activities of daily living (ADLs) and instrumental activities of daily living (IADLs) that the care recipient requires assistance with. ADLs may include tasks such as bathing, dressing, and eating, while IADLs may include managing finances, transportation, and meal preparation. Clearly outline these tasks in the care plan to ensure that the caregiver is aware of their responsibilities.
  3. Medication Management: If the care recipient requires assistance with medication management, specify the medications, dosages, and schedules in the care plan. It is important to provide clear instructions and ensure that the caregiver understands the proper administration of medication.
  4. Emergency Procedures: Include emergency contact information, medical history, and any specific emergency procedures that the caregiver should be aware of. This information will ensure that the caregiver can respond appropriately in case of an emergency or unexpected situation.

Monitoring Caregiver Performance

Monitoring the performance of your caregiver is an essential part of managing CDPAP services. This ensures that the caregiver is providing the necessary assistance and meeting your needs effectively. Here are some considerations for evaluating caregiver performance:

  1. Regular Check-ins: Schedule regular check-ins with your caregiver to discuss any concerns or questions you may have. This allows for open communication and provides an opportunity to address any issues promptly.
  2. Observation: Observe the caregiver's interactions with you or your loved one during their shifts. Pay attention to their punctuality, professionalism, and adherence to the care plan. Note any areas where improvement may be needed.
  3. Feedback: Offer constructive feedback to your caregiver on their performance. Communicate openly about your expectations and provide guidance on areas that require improvement. Recognize and appreciate their efforts when they meet or exceed expectations.
  4. Documentation: Keep a record of the caregiver's performance. Document any incidents, concerns, or positive experiences that occur during their service. This documentation can serve as a reference if any issues arise in the future.

Addressing Issues and Concerns

In the course of receiving CDPAP services, you may encounter issues or concerns that require attention. Promptly addressing these matters is crucial for maintaining the quality of care provided. Here are some steps to address issues and concerns effectively:

  1. Open Communication: Establish a channel of open communication with your caregiver. Encourage them to share any concerns they may have and address those concerns promptly. Similarly, communicate your concerns to the caregiver in a respectful and clear manner.
  2. Contact the CDPAP Administrator: If you are unable to resolve an issue with your caregiver directly, reach out to the CDPAP administrator. They can provide guidance, mediate disputes, and offer assistance in finding a resolution.
  3. Review the Care Plan: If an issue arises, review the care plan to ensure that it accurately reflects your needs. If necessary, update the care plan to address any gaps or changes in the required assistance.
  4. Seek Support: If you feel overwhelmed or need additional support, consider reaching out to support services available in your community. These services can provide guidance and assistance in navigating any challenges you may face during the CDPAP process.
